Another trademark the vehicle has become well known for over the years is its reliability and durability.

Thanks to an overall well designed 2.4 L four cylinder engine with 155 horsepower or a 3.3 L V6 with 220 horsepower, many Highlander drivers are cruising into the 200K mile range without any major concerns. The four cylinder offers an amazing 22 city and 25 highway mpg but is only offered with two rows of seating. For the elusive third row option drivers will have to upgrade to the better V6 option for the vehicle that still produces an admirable 19 city and 23 highway mpg. The third row is fairly small for the vehicle and truly only sits two children but can be highly valuable for the growing family. The V6 option is perfect for the road trip family or college driver that needs a small U-Haul for extra luggage. However; the shorter height of the Highlander does mean that attaching luggage to the roof is relatively easy.

The driveability of the Toyota Highlander is much like the interior; quiet and comfortable. Among its crossover competitors on our Buy Here Pay Here lot, the Highlander drives most like a simple sedan with the most visibility thanks to sleek frame-pillar designs. The vehicle also ranks highly with the National Highway Traffic Safety Administration earning five stars for front, side, and rollover collisions. The Highlander also has more safety features than its competitors among used cars in Alexandria, Va with electronic stability and traction control, electronic brake-force distribution, anti-lock brakes, and emergency brake assist.
